Normal Boot Menu Normal Boot order according to the type of bootable media.
This lists only the types of boot media for which at
least one bootable media is available.
Example: "CD/DVD-ROM Drive" can be selected as
the boot media type if a CD-ROM drive is installed as
a boot medium, for example.

Boot Type Order Submenu
2
for setting the boot sequence of the following boot media types.
Default setting:
1. Floppy drive
2. Hard Disk Drive
3. CD/DVD ROM Drive
4. USB
5. Others

Others Submenu
2
for setting the boot sequence within the group of yet to be
detected boot media, for example, LAN/PXE ports (Remote Boot Devices).
PXE: LAN 1/2 Remote Boot: If PXE Boot capability is enabled (see above),
these are the PXE boot media for each LAN interface. When selected,
booting is via the network/PXE from this LAN port.
